Thorpe-do misses the target


STOCKHOLM: Australian swimming great Ian Thorpe claimed he had swum his greatest ever 400m short course race here on Tuesday as he came within five hundredths of a second of breaking compatriot Grant Hackett’s world record. 

The 20-year-old ‘Thorpedo’ posted a time of 3:34.63sec just short of Hackett’s mark (3:34.58) set in Sydney last July on the penultimate meet of the World Cup series.
